Drawing heavily on the authors own real-world experiences  the book stresses design and analysis. Coverage is divided into two parts  the first being a general guide to techniques for the design and analysis of computer algorithms. The second is a reference section  which includes a catalog of the 75 most important algorithmic problems. By browsing this catalog  readers can quickly identify what the problem they have encountered is called  what is known about it  and how they should proceed if they need to solve it. This book is ideal for the working professional who uses algorithms on a daily basis and has need for a handy reference. This work can also readily be used in an upper-division course or as a student reference guide.
